Installation Tips for Loud Wired Doorbells

Installing a loud wired doorbell can be a straightforward process with the right tools and knowledge. Start by turning off the power to the existing doorbell circuit at your electrical panel to ensure safety during installation. Next, remove the old doorbell, making note of the wiring setup. Most doorbells will have two wires: one for the transformer and one for the chime.

Once the old unit is out, unpack your new loud wired doorbell to familiarize yourself with its components. Carefully connect the wires from the wall to the corresponding terminals on the new doorbell. It’s essential to ensure a secure connection to maintain functionality. After the wiring is complete, mount the doorbell to the wall, secure it in place, and attach the faceplate.

Finally, restore power to the circuit and test your new doorbell. Make sure to walk through your home to verify that the sound level meets your expectations in all rooms. If necessary, make adjustments to the volume settings or chime options to enhance your experience.

Maintenance and Troubleshooting for Loud Wired Doorbells

Maintaining a loud wired doorbell is relatively simple, but it’s important to perform periodic checks to ensure its longevity and functionality. Start by inspecting the wiring every few months for any signs of wear or damage. Corroded or frayed wires can lead to decreased performance or complete failure of the doorbell system. If you spot any issues, it’s advisable to replace or repair them promptly.

Another essential aspect of maintenance is keeping the doorbell clean. Dust and debris can accumulate over time, potentially affecting the sound quality and aesthetics of the doorbell. A soft cloth and mild cleaning solution can help maintain its appearance and functionality. Regularly cleaning the chime box and external buttons can also prevent buildup that might impact performance.

If you experience problems with your loud wired doorbell, troubleshooting can often identify simple issues. Check the power supply to ensure that the circuit is functional. If the doorbell doesn’t ring, inspect the connections again to verify that they are secure. In case of persistent problems, consulting the product manual or contacting customer service may provide further assistance.

5. Durability and Weather Resistance

Since your doorbell will be installed outside, it needs to withstand varying weather conditions, including rain, snow, and even intense sunlight. Look for the IP rating of the doorbell, which indicates its level of protection against dust and moisture. An IP rating of at least IP65 is desirable, ensuring the unit is resistant to water and dust.

Durability goes beyond just weather resistance; consider the materials used in construction. Stainless steel or high-quality plastic can offer greater longevity than cheaper materials that may fade or degrade over time. Investing in a durable doorbell means it will serve you reliably for years without requiring frequent replacement.

How loud are most wired doorbells?

Most wired doorbells are designed to reach volume levels between 80 and 120 decibels, making them significantly louder than many wireless options. This volume range is usually adequate to alert residents in various settings, including large homes or those with background noise from appliances or other sources. Be sure to check the specifications of individual models to find one that meets your volume requirements.

However, it’s important to remember that loudness isn’t the only factor to consider. The quality of sound produced is equally important; a clear tone will typically be more effective than a mere loud sound. Look for models that offer adjustable volume settings so you can customize the chime loudness to your preferences and environment.
